Advancements in Design for Easier Repairs

One of the standout revelations from the teardown of the Pixel 10 Pro XL is the noticeable improvement in battery removal compared to earlier models in the Pixel series. This change marks a deliberate shift by Google to make maintenance more accessible, a move that resonates with the growing call for devices that can be fixed rather than replaced. The design allows for simpler access to key components, with entry from the rear of the phone for most internal repairs and a streamlined front-access process for screen replacements involving just a single cable. Such thoughtful engineering suggests that Google is listening to feedback from both professional technicians and DIY enthusiasts who value straightforward repair processes. While this progress is commendable, opinions on its impact vary, with some experts noting that these enhancements, though positive, may not fully meet the highest benchmarks of repair-friendly design. Nevertheless, this step forward indicates a promising trajectory for future iterations of the Pixel lineup.

Industry Trends and Mixed Reactions

The broader landscape of smartphone manufacturing is increasingly leaning toward sustainability, with repairability becoming a key focus due to consumer demand for cost-effective and eco-conscious technology. The Pixel 10 Pro XL’s design improvements align with this trend, reflecting Google’s commitment to adapting to these expectations, even if the pace of change draws mixed reactions from repair advocates. Some view the easier battery replacement as a significant win, a practical advancement that could extend the lifespan of the device for many users. Others, however, temper their enthusiasm, pointing out that certain repair challenges persist, suggesting that Google’s efforts, while noteworthy, fall short of a complete overhaul in repair-friendly innovation. This divergence in perspective underscores a critical dialogue within the tech world about balancing cutting-edge features with practical maintenance needs.
